What is Quran Hifz?
Hifz refers to the memorization of the Quran, the holy book of Islam, in its entirety. A person who commits the entire Quran to memory is honored with the title of Hafiz or Hafiza (for females). This noble act is deeply revered in Islam, as the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him) said:
“The best among you are those who learn the Quran and teach it.” (Bukhari)
Traditionally, Hifz was carried out in madrasas or mosques under the supervision of qualified scholars. Today, with the rise of online education, Quran Hifz has taken on a new digital form.

Challenges of Quran Hifz Online (And How to Overcome Them)
While online Hifz offers many benefits, it's not without challenges:
Screen Fatigue: Long screen time can affect concentration. Solution: keep sessions short and engaging.
Lack of Motivation: Without physical peers, some students may feel isolated. Solution: set daily goals, rewards, and parental encouragement.
Distractions at Home: A quiet, dedicated space for learning helps minimize interruptions.
Consistent parental involvement, strong teacher-student rapport, and a disciplined routine are crucial to overcome these challenges.

Spiritual Benefits of Memorizing the Quran
Becoming a Hafiz is not merely an academic achievement—it is a spiritual elevation. Memorizing the Quran brings:
Closeness to Allah (SWT)
Increased barakah (blessings) in life
A high status in both this world and the Hereafter
Mental discipline and clarity
A role as a beacon of guidance for others
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him) also said:
“It will be said to the companion of the Quran: Recite and rise in status. Recite as you used to recite in the world. Your status will be at the last verse you recite.” (Abu Dawood)
